The distinct low-poly minimalist aesthetic is both a deliberate stylistic choice and a technical advantage. By reducing texture sizes and polygon counts, the game runs smoothly at high frame rates on low-spec hardware, such as basic school Chromebooks, without causing significant hardware slowdowns or browser crashes. A core pillar of the game’s longevity is its robust level editor. Players are not restricted to pre-made developer tracks. The intuitive construction kit allows users to build custom, complex stunts, export their creation codes, and share them with classmates. , often found on Classroom 6x (a hub for unblocked games designed for school environments), is a fast-paced, low-poly racing game. The core of the game is focused on speed, precision, and maneuvering through complex tracks filled with loops, jumps, and sharp, treacherous turns. polytrack classroom 6x
